Hdb Shophouse Serangoon Ave 4 Going 198 Mil

A 99-year leasehold HDB shophouse at 214 Serangoon Avenue 4 will be up for auction at SRI’s next sale on Feb 26. The two-storey shophouse, which includes living quarters on the second level, has a total floor area of approximately 1,668 sq ft. The property has been listed with a guide price of $1.98 million, equivalent to $1,187 psf on the floor area. This is a mortgagee sale, and it will be the second time the property has been featured at SRI’s auction. It was previously listed last month with a higher guide price of $2.08 million but did not find a buyer. According to Jansen Kee, assistant manager of auctions at SRI, the shophouse enjoys a prominent location in front of a bus stop, giving it good visibility from the road.

The shophouse is currently tenanted and generates a gross rental yield of approximately 6.2% based on the guide price, says Kee. He adds that the unit will be sold along with its existing lease, which expires in 2026. This will provide the new owner with an immediate stream of rental income. Kee notes that the listed guide price for the HDB shophouse is one of the most affordable in the area, making it an attractive prospect for both investors and owner-occupiers. According to URA records, the most recent commercial shophouse transaction in Serangoon was the sale of a 999-year leasehold shophouse along Lichfield Road. The two-storey property covered a land area of 2,319 sq ft and sold for $4 million ($1,725 psf) in November 2024.

The property up for auction is situated within a cluster of HDB flats that borders the Serangoon Gardens landed residential estate. It is located directly across the road from Serangoon Swimming Complex and Serangoon Sports Centre, which provides the area with a steady flow of foot traffic. Carpark lots are available behind the shophouse.
